Gold Revived On Iran's Missile Tests

Gold regained ground on Wednesday as speculators resurfaced on news that Iran has test fired nine long- and medium-range missiles, lifting the metal's safe-haven appeal in times of uncertainty.
Gold was steady at $921.65/922.65 an ounce from $921.35/922.55 an ounce late in New York on Tuesday, having hit an intraday low of $915.60 an ounce.
